Question: 58mm thread to 4 1/2 adapter

Anyone know how to put a 4 1/2 round filter onto a 58mm (GL2, VX2000..) thread?
And where to find such a thing. Looking for an adapter setup. Thanks.

You need a set of stepdown rings. This would include a ring big enough to hold the filter. It is threaded on the inside and outside. A retainer ring screws into the top part of the big ring to hold your filter in, then the bottom of the ring would have 58mm threads. You can call someplace that handles those to get the right combination. A Series 9 to 58mm is common, but 4.5" is bigger than Series 9.
